Sr Procurement Operations Analyst
Kildare, Ireland; Dublin, Ireland Job ID 142538 Job Category Procurement Job Level Individual Contributor Position Type Full-TimeJob Overview:
The Procurement Senior Analyst supports KDP Global Sourcing by ensuring strong end-to-end service performance, resolving issues, and driving ongoing process improvements. The role has a strong SAP focus, requiring hands-on experience with SAP MM to manage procurement transactions, monitor material and purchase order flows, and improve operational execution across suppliers and manufacturing plants.
A key responsibility is serving as a subject‑matter expert for SAP-enabled procurement processes, with deep working knowledge of SAP MM and Ariba Supply Chain Collaboration (SCC). This includes supporting system rollout, supplier enablement, troubleshooting transactional issues, and driving continuous optimization across purchase orders, master data, goods movements, and supplier collaboration workflows. The Analyst partners closely with IT, Category Management, Finance, and Master Data teams to maintain data integrity, streamline processes, and ensure alignment with broader business requirements.
The position also contributes to major integration initiatives, supports project milestones, and advances governance, analytics, and operational efficiency across KDP Global Sourcing. The management and mentoring of external support resources is also a function of this role.

Requirements:
- Bachelor’s degree in Supply Chain, Operations, Business or Technology
- 5+ years of experience in Direct Materials Procurement
- Strong hands-on, super user experience with SAP MM is required, including procurement transactions, purchase order processing, material master data, and issue resolution in SAP
- Experience working with SAP Ariba Supply Chain Collaboration is preferred
- Proficient in MS Office Suite with advanced knowledge of Excel required
- Solid data analytics skills to obtain insights and determine the required actions. An intermediate level of Power BI knowledge is required.
- Ability to define problems, collect data, establish facts, and draw valid conclusions
- Strong communication skills with internal stakeholders, external customers, and suppliers
Company Overview:
Keurig Dr Pepper (Nasdaq: KDP) is a leading beverage company with more than 150 owned, licensed and partner brands that meet a wide range of needs and occasions. Our North American refreshment beverage business holds leadership positions across carbonated soft drinks, water, juice and mixers with a portfolio of iconic brands such as Dr Pepper®, Canada Dry®, Mott’s®, A&W®, Peñafiel®, GHOST®, 7UP®, Snapple®, Clamato® and Core Hydration®. Our global coffee business spans more than 100 markets and includes the leading Keurig® single‑serve brewing system in the U.S. and Canada, along with powerhouse brands such as Peet’s, L’OR and Jacobs, and other regional coffee leaders. Our more than 50,000 employees aim to enhance the experience of every beverage and coffee occasion while making a positive impact for people, communities and the planet.
